Why Replace Your Doors and Windows?
Improved Energy Efficiency
Outdated windows and doors with windows can lead to drafts, air leaks, and higher energy bills as your heating or cooling system works overtime to preserve a comfortable indoor temperature level. Modern replacements feature energy-efficient materials like double or triple-pane glass, low-E finishings, and insulated frames, which minimize energy loss and keep your home comfy year-round.
Improved Security
Older windows and doors might do not have the required locking systems or structural integrity to keep your home safe. New replacement choices typically consist of strengthened glass, multi-point locking systems, and tough products like fiberglass or steel, supplying assurance versus prospective burglaries.
Curb Appeal and Value
Changing an old, damaged front door or a dated window style instantly refreshes your home's exterior appearance. Whether you're choosing streamlined modern components or timeless, classic designs, new doors and windows enhance curb appeal and can substantially increase residential or commercial property worth.
Lowered Maintenance
New products typically include weather-resistant finishes and require less upkeep compared to older styles. For example, vinyl windows and fiberglass doors resist warping, rot, and rust-- making them ideal for those who desire low-maintenance upgrades.
Sound Reduction
If you live near busy streets or metropolitan areas, changing older windows or doors with soundproofing technologies can noticeably minimize outside noise, producing a quieter and more tranquil home.
Picking the Right Material
When it concerns door or window replacement, the product makes all the distinction. Here are common materials you can select from:
Vinyl: Cost-effective, resilient, and practically maintenance-free, vinyl is an outstanding choice for window upvc door replacements. It provides great insulation and resists warping or breaking gradually.
Wood: For a more standard or rustic appearance, wood is a classic option. While stunning and energy-efficient, wood requires routine maintenance to prevent rot and warping.
Fiberglass: Durable, energy-efficient, and adjustable, fiberglass windows and doors provide the very best of both worlds: strength and visual appeals. They can mimic wood without the maintenance hassles.
Steel: Offering top-notch security and toughness, steel is a popular choice for entry doors. It holds up well against extreme climate condition however can be susceptible to dents.
Aluminum: Lightweight and smooth, aluminum is great for modern-day styles. However, it's less energy-efficient compared to other materials and may not perform too in extreme environments.
Expense Considerations
The cost of windows and door door windows Replacement replacements depends upon numerous factors, including the size, products, customization, and intricacy of installation. Here's a basic breakdown:
Windows: On average, changing windows can cost $300 to $1,200 per window, depending upon the material and features. Including customized sizes, energy-efficient coatings, or specialty styles will increase the cost.
Doors: Standard door replacement ranges from $500 to $2,000 per door windows replacement. Entry aluminium doors and windows, security doors, and sliding glass doors (which need larger panes of glass) tend to be more expensive.
While the in advance expenses might seem high, keep in mind that energy-efficient doors and windows can help you conserve considerably on your utility costs gradually, ultimately balancing out the initial financial investment.
The Installation Process
Replacing doors and windows is a job finest delegated specialists, however understanding the procedure can assist make sure everything goes efficiently.
Assessment and Measurement: An expert specialist will inspect your current windows and doors, examine the condition of the existing frames, and take exact measurements to guarantee the replacements fit properly.
Selecting Styles and Features: Once the measurements are taken, you'll have the opportunity to choose the style, material, and additional features, such as energy-efficient glass or decorative information.
Elimination of Old Units: The installers will remove your old doors or windows carefully to avoid unneeded damage to the surrounding frames, walls, or floor covering.
Installation of Replacements: New doors or windows are set up, sealed, and checked to make sure correct positioning, functionality, and energy effectiveness.
Last Clean-Up and Inspection: Once the job is total, the worksite is cleaned up, and the specialists will walk you through the results to ensure everything satisfies your expectations.
Do It Yourself vs Professional Installation
While DIY door and window replacement may appear like a cost-saving choice, it's not constantly advisable unless you have skilled know-how and specialized tools. Improper setup can lead to air leakages, water damage, and structural concerns. Employing licensed experts ensures the task is finished quickly and correctly, typically with service warranties for included protection.
